Molon Labe Soap, "Come Take Them".
A classical expression of defiance, for the MEN of Sparta!
A soap designed by man for men.
A saying reported by Plutarch of King Leonidas I in reply to the demand by Xerxes I that the Spartans put down their weapons. The exchange between Leonidas and Xerxes occurs in writing, on the eve of the Battle of Thermopylae 480 BC.

BASE
Soap, meant for cleaning skin surface. No claims, except for the by-product of (possible) delight, are made about these soaps.
Ingredients: Craftiness, Lard Glyceride, Cocos Nucifera Oil (Coconut Oil), Butyrospermum Parkii (Shea Butter), Aloe Barbadensis Leaf Extract (Aloe Butter), Olea Europaea (Olive Oil), Ricinus Communis (Castor Oil), Theobroma Cocoa (Cocoa Butter),sodium hydroxide, Aqua, fragrance oils, colorants, and raw silk.
